Ipamorelin
IPA
Also: NNC 26-0161
§ Overview
A selective growth hormone secretagogue that stimulates GH release without significantly affecting cortisol, prolactin, or other hormones. Considered the 'cleanest' GHRP due to its selectivity. Frequently combined with CJC-1295 for enhanced GH pulsatility.
§ Mechanism
Selectively binds to ghrelin/GHS receptors (GHSR) on the pituitary gland, triggering growth hormone release in a pulsatile pattern that mimics natural GH secretion. Unique among GHRPs for minimal effect on appetite (ghrelin), cortisol, and prolactin.
